Handover — Gallery Labels

Mira: labels for the Tidewater Hall gallery came back from Quillstone Print today. All 84 mounted, proofed, and boxed in two flat cartons by the loading dock. Curator approved the final set, no reprints needed. Courier from Brackenline picks up tomorrow before noon for delivery to the museum annex. Carton seals are intact — don't open them. The confidential hand-over instruction for the courier follows below.

dispatch memo: the holvan novvan courier leaves the sorys norwyn druix gorwyn lamius ulaix eliax keliel ledger at gate 7514 under passcode 469337

Subject: Velmora unit sale — heads up

Team,

Quick note before the all-hands: we've signed a letter of intent to sell the Velmora accessories unit to Kestrel Ridge Holdings. Nothing changes for current pipeline — keep closing as usual, and don't speculate with customers. Mira Odell will field questions at Thursday's sync. Legal expects diligence to wrap by end of quarter. Please treat this as sensitive until the public announcement. The note below covers what comes next.

confidential, baweg-bahaf: Brivanax Logistics is in early talks to buy Sordorek Freight for about $52.6 million. The Briion launch date is January 22, and nothing goes to the press before then.

Capacity note for the Marrowfield catalog cache (Tindervale region). Invalidation fan-out spikes whenever the merchandising team at Pellicor runs a bulk price sync: each SKU touch evicts up to four derived keys, and the purge queue can back up behind the nightly reindex. If you see sustained queue depth above the alert threshold, throttle the sync rather than raising worker count — extra workers stampede the origin store. All knobs live in one config block; the values we ship with are as follows.

tuning table, yajog-yahof:
BUDGETS = {
    "lamvan": 303,
    "wenox": 460,
    "fenvan": 525,
}

Handover note — from Edwin to next shift. The Tallow & Finch mantel clock goes to Rooksmere Restorations tomorrow. It's padded and boxed in bay 3, movement secured, key taped inside the lid. One driver, direct run, no overnight holds. Customer is anxious, so confirm delivery by phone once signed for. Pass the courier the instruction below at hand-over.

handover note for tafog-bawef: the ulair kasael courier leaves the ralok gilmir fenael druwyn feneth queniel belix keliel ledger at gate 5216 under passcode 961436